    It's mathematics at this point. What hazards does driver either bring in or take out of play? Same for the iron. How tough is the rough and how much better are you from 100 yards in the fairway 80% of the time vs 40 yards in the rough 50% of the time, if at all?

    The main thing you have to avoid at all costs under 100 yards are fairway bunkers. Tour players tend to average nearly the same strokes to get down from fairway bunkers from 80-180 yards.

    Harvey Pennick said to close the blade on those half wedges if you've been hitting lateral shots. Can't shank with a closed face. Or try to consciously hit it on the toe. Or force yourself to roll the toe of the club over through the shot.

    Could be too much lower body action forcing you to get stuck and hit it off the hosel.

    Try hitting those shots with your feet together and see if that fixes it. If so, likely too much lower body action, particularly the right knee.

    I prefer a full or 3/4 swing over half swings. Not because of shanks or contact issues but because of distance control. I don't practice those in between shots enough to have any touch. I'd rather leave myself somewhere between 70-110 yards. I can 3/4 or full swing my 50, 54, or 58 in that range and feel confident in my distance control.

    As for your shanks, my best guess is you're decelerating going into impact. It could be because you're way inside on your backswing or you're worried about distance control and slow down at impact.
